Why a Carry-On Matters More Than Check-In for Most Travellers
If you fly more than 2–3 times a year, a quality carry-on saves more time and stress than a quality check-in:
- Skip baggage claim entirely — walk straight out of the arrivals hall 10–30 minutes faster than checked-baggage passengers
- Zero lost-luggage risk — your bag is with you the entire journey, including connections
- Essentials always with you — passport, medications, laptop, a change of clothes; essential for international connections where your checked bag might not make the transfer
- Lower trip cost — budget airlines (Jetstar, AirAsia) often charge $50–$100 per checked bag; carry-on-only travel saves these fees
- Forces efficient packing — the 7 kg limit is a discipline that results in lighter, less stressful travel
NZ Airline Carry-On Size Limits 2026
All Kiwibag 20" carry-ons are designed to fit the strictest common NZ airline limit (Jetstar/Qantas 56 × 36 × 23 cm). This means any Kiwibag 20" carry-on works on every major airline serving New Zealand:
| Airline | Max dimensions | Max weight |
|---|---|---|
| Air New Zealand | 118 cm combined | 7 kg |
| Jetstar Economy | 56 × 36 × 23 cm | 7 kg (10 kg with Plus) |
| Qantas Economy | 56 × 36 × 23 cm | 7 kg |
| Virgin Australia | 56 × 36 × 23 cm | 7 kg |
| Emirates Economy | 55 × 38 × 22 cm | 7 kg |
| Singapore Airlines | 115 cm combined | 7 kg |

Packing a 7 kg Carry-On Efficiently
- Weigh the empty suitcase first — Kiwibag 20" carry-ons are 2.8–3.3 kg empty, leaving 3.7–4.2 kg of packing allowance
- Wear the heaviest clothing on the plane — boots, jacket, jumper
- Roll clothes instead of folding — saves 20–30% more space
- Pack shoes around the edges in fabric bags to save centre space
- Keep liquids under 100 ml each, in a clear resealable bag (TSA requirement for international flights)
- Laptop in a padded sleeve inside the main compartment, or in your personal item (most airlines allow 1 carry-on + 1 personal item)
- Weigh with a luggage scale at home — overweight fees at the gate are $50–$130

Will a 20-inch carry-on fit Air New Zealand's size limit?
Yes. Air NZ's carry-on limit is 118 cm combined and 7 kg. A 20" carry-on measures approximately 112 cm combined (55 × 35 × 22 cm) — well within the size limit. The 7 kg weight limit is typically the tighter constraint; weigh your packed bag at home to confirm.

What's the weight limit for Jetstar carry-on?
7 kg for economy. 10 kg if you've purchased the Jetstar Plus carry-on upgrade. Size limit is 56 × 36 × 23 cm.

Hard shell or soft shell carry-on?
Hard shell for most travellers — more durable in airline handling, water-resistant, and doesn't absorb odours. Kiwibag's full carry-on range is hard shell.
